Libinia emarginata, or common spider crab, is native to the Atlantic coast of North America. It lives at depths of up to 160 ft (49 m), with exceptional records of up to 400 ft (120 m). Adults are sluggish and not aggressive, and younger crabs are frequently covered with sponges and hydroids. L. emarginata preferentially walks forwards, rather than sideways, although they are also capable of sidelong movement. (X)
